The stoichiometry of the
granulocyte-macrophage colony-stimulating factor
(
GM-CSF
) receptor complex is still unresolved. We have utilised a sensitive, functional assay for receptor homodimerisation to show that
GM-CSF
induces dimerisation of the common signalling subunit, hbeta(c). We generated a chimeric cytokine receptor in which the extracellular and transmembrane domains of hbeta(c)are fused to the cytoplasmic domain of erythropoietin receptor (EPO-R). Given that to induce EPO-R activation and mitogenic signalling there is a requirement for formation of a specific homodimeric complex, we reasoned that the cytoplasmic domain of EPO-R could be utilised as a highly sensitive reporter for functional homodimer formation. We show that, in the presence of a cytoplasmically truncated
GM-CSF
alpha-subunit, the hbetac-
EPO
receptor chimera transduces a mitogenic signal in BaF-B03 in response to
GM-CSF
. This is consistent with formation of a hbeta(c)homodimer following
GM-CSF
binding and implies that ligand stimulation induces formation of a higher order complex that contains the hbeta(c)homodimer.
